Yes and geographic discovery is one of the most dependable filters you have, because where an audience lives is concrete data rather than a judgement call. The one distinction that matters is creator location versus audience location. A creator can live in one country while most of the people following them sit somewhere else, so filtering on the home city of a creator can hand you reach in the wrong market. What you almost always want is audience location, the share of followers who are in the country or region you sell to, since that is the reach you are paying for. A creator based abroad with a heavy following in your market can be a better fit than a local creator whose audience is scattered worldwide.
So the practical way to discover region-specific creators is to filter on audience geography and set a threshold, for example a clear majority of the audience inside your target country, then layer your other filters (niche, size, engagement) on top. For city-level or language-specific targeting the same logic holds, you are matching the audience to the place and language of your buyers. Done this way, regional discovery is fast and reliable and it stops the common waste of paying a local-sounding creator whose followers cannot buy from you. So yes, you can discover influencers by region or country and the key is to filter on where the audience is, not just where the creator lives, which is what makes the reach actually land in your market.
